Marketing Manager - Product Content

Mass General Brigham (Enterprise Services)
United States, Massachusetts, Somerville
399 Revolution Drive (Show on map)
Mar 13, 2026
The Marketing Manager - Product Content supports all aspects of editorial production for digital content supporting Mass General Brigham's marketing and communications, with a specific focus on website content. This role involves developing, editing, optimizing, and distributing service line content targeting patients, consumers, and referring providers to drive acquisition, growth, and brand awareness. The ideal candidate will have expertise in SEO, user experience, audience engagement, and content marketing, along with a strong understanding of how content fulfills audience needs and informs data-driven decisions.
This individual is a proactive, detail-oriented, adaptable, and data-driven problem solver who thrives in a fast-paced environment. They coll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ure alignment on project interdependencies and timely delivery of digital content for prioritized initiatives and service lines. This position requires strong leadership skills and the ability to manage complex projects from inception to completion.
Reporting to the Sr. Marketing Manager, Product Content, this individual helps direct editorial processes, executes the editorial calendar, and coordinates the distribution of service line content across Mass General Brigham's digital channels.
Working closely with marketing, clinical, research, educational, and administrative teams, the Marketing Manager - Product Content ensures digital properties effectively communicate marketing priorities, support organizational goals, and accurately represent the brand.

Education

  • Bachelor's Degree in a related field of study required

  • Equivalent experience may be accepted in lieu of degree

Experience

  • 5+ years of related experience required

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ills, including superior writing and editing skills

  • Outstanding oral and written communication

  • Familiarity with digital content creation tools

  • Familiarity with SEO writing and plain language writing, health literacy, and/or writing at different grade levels for different audiences

  • Experience with digital content creation tools

  • Experience with digital analytics tools

  • Proven professional, able to work effectively with a variety of personality types and job levels

  • Ability to move quickly in a constantly evolving and often ambiguous environment

  • Strong attention to detail and quality

  • Proven initiative, self-direction

  • Committed to teamwork and collaboration

  • Sound judgment and decision-making

  • High levels of tact, diplomacy, and fine-tuned consultative skills

  • Confident and comfortable working within a matrixed organization

  •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ously and meet deadlines

  • Ability to interact with professionals at all levels throughout a large, diverse health care organization

  • Working knowledge of MS Office applications, including Outlook, Word, PowerPoint and Excel

  • Positive, can-do attitude

  • Digitally savvy
